Every Coronation Street Theo murder suspect ranked from least to most likely

Theo Silverton’s reign of terror over husband Todd Grimshaw has finally come to an end — but the fallout from his death is still sending shockwaves across Coronation Street. In Wednesday’s episode (6 May) of the ITV soap, George Shuttleworth was seen emerging from a disturbed night in police custody after being questioned over Theo’s murder and released under investigation.

As George, Todd and Christina tried to process the escalating situation, suspicion continued to build across the cobbles, with multiple residents having both motive and history with Theo following the discovery of his abusive behaviour towards Todd.

While George remains at the centre of the investigation, he’s far from the only suspect. Theo alienated several people in the months leading up to his death and emotions have been running high since his abuse was exposed. Soap bosses have recently confirmed six key suspects, but each one carries a different level of suspicion.

Theo Silverton’s ex-wife (played by Natalie Anderson) wasn’t on the cobbles on the day of his death, immediately making her one of the less likely suspects. She also shares two children with Theo (Miles and Millie) and was last seen quietly leaving flowers following his death without engaging with anyone on the Street.

Prior to this, Danielle has been questioned by Sarah about Theo’s behaviour and became defensive when abuse allegations were raised. But there has been nothing to suggest she acted beyond that. Some viewers may believe she acted out of revenge for Theo’s affair with Todd but could Danielle really leave her children fatherless to settle a score?

As one of Todd’s closest friends, Sarah (Tina O’Brien) was horrified after discovering the extent of Theo’s abuse. She previously attempted to take Theo’s tablet in order to gather evidence against him. That same device has now gone missing and is being treated as key evidence in the investigation.

However, Sarah’s movements on the night of Theo’s death work against her being the killer. She was seen entering No.8 before being struck on the head by Jodie Ramsey, meaning she spent several hours in hospital and effectively has an alibi. He relationship with DC Kit Green also further reduces suspicion, suggesting she is unlikely to have crossed a line into murder — unless Theo’s death was an accident.

Christina (Amy Robbins) may not have a direct link to Todd, but her protective instincts over her partner George has placed her under scrutiny. She was the first to panic after noticing blood on George’s shirt this Wednesday, raising concerns that were later overheard by DS Lisa Swain.

Her past also works against her. Before her relationship with George, Christina was introduced as a far more ruthless character, and the darker edge could point to her being capable of extreme action if she believed it was necessary. If she acted, she may have been trying to protect George and Todd, rather than out of personal motive.

George (Tony Maudsley) has long acted like a father figure to Todd and has been openly hostile towards Theo following revelations about his abuse. He helped Todd prepare to leave Theo and was present during the confrontation that saw Theo locked in his own bathroom.

Importantly, George has no solid alibi for the night of the murder, having been sent out walking alone during the key timeframe. Despite this, his emotional connection to Todd makes it difficult to imagine him going as far as murder.
